Which verb should I use?

How can i say i agree with someone's words?

'I endorse with your words.'

'I support your words.'

Or maybe simply 'I agree with your words.'

  

Top answer

' No. I agree with what you say/said.

  • ' No.
  • I agree with what you say/said.
